The key to choosing a liquid stick packaging machine depends on three indicators: flexibility, accuracy and whether it is easy to maintain in the later stage.
To make this return on investment even higher, I strongly recommend that you prioritize models equipped with high-precision piston pumps and PLC control systems, preferably with an intuitive and easy-to-use HMI touchscreen. Even if you don’t have a dedicated technician, you can easily adjust the filling volume and sealing temperature through this system to handle various viscosity materials from thin as water to thick as glue.
A truly professional industrial-grade device must have a vertical forming fill seal mechanism and a stable back seal structure, which are hard conditions to prevent leakage. At the same time, all parts that come into contact with the material must be made of 316 or 304 stainless steel, which is the bottom line for meeting GMP standards and food safety specifications. Choosing a machine with a compact structure, stable accuracy and easy parts cleaning can not only help you reduce film loss and labor costs, but also directly improve the texture of your packaging by one level, making it truly competitive in the market.

Deep Cooperation Between PLC System And HMI
In the line of automated packaging, precision directly equals profit. The PLC is the brain equivalent of this liquid stick packing machine, which synchronously controls the membrane pulling, bagging, filling and sealing actions with millisecond precision.
I have come into contact with many bosses who have no technical background and are most afraid that the machine will be difficult to use. At this time, the good HMI touch screen became a lifesaver. It reduces complex mechanical engineering logic into intuitive instructions. You can fine-tune the sealing temperature directly on the screen to fit different packaging films, or fine-tune the filling volume to avoid spillage. From what I’ve observed, this high level of control ensures that every bag of strips you release is exactly the same, which is crucial to maintaining a brand’s high-end image.

Leaks are the most troublesome pit in liquid packaging. At best, they can contaminate the entire batch of goods, and at worst, they can attract customer complaints. To combat this problem, professional equipment uses the VFFS mechanism. This gravity-assisted process allows liquid to flow more smoothly into the bag, and then completes precise positioning before sealing.
“Back seal” is much more reliable than side seal when sealing liquids. It is more evenly stressed and forms a very stable leak-proof barrier. Combined with the sensitive temperature sensor, the integrity of the seal will not be compromised even if the machine is running at full power and high frequency. This is also required by large retailers worldwide “leakproof guarantee”.
Sticking To GMP And Stainless Steel Standards
If you’re running a food, beverage, or pharmaceutical line, compliance is non-negotiable. A qualified liquid stick packing machine, all contact parts must be made of 304 or even 316 stainless steel. It’s not just about sturdiness, it’s more about corrosion resistance and hygiene.
As required by GMP, these machines must be designed with “easily removable and washable” logic in mind. Those quick-install components and polished surfaces can effectively prevent bacterial growth, and the disinfection work during the change of production can also be much faster. This adherence to materials can ensure that your equipment will not rust or lose its chain after years of use when facing acidic or alkaline liquids.
